I found this scene in a music video after revisiting one of my favorite bands, STREETLIGHT MANIFESTO. I’m somewhat ashamed to admit it, but i had lost connection with this high energy ska roots band and hadn’t checked in on them for quite some time.
I was pleasantly surprised to find an imaginative music video for the song WOULD YOU BE IMPRESSED. And yes, i would be impressed.
The video is as fast paced, energetic, and as meaningful as the song it represents. The animation is smooth, eye catching, and full of nice effects ( character movements, camera work, and BLOOD! ). I may be biased, but any music video that is animated has a special place in my heart.
In this tale of actions vs consequence, the band members are transformed into animals, with band leader Tomas Kalnoky as an appropriate lion. People beat on the animals, the animals fight back.
The message is clear: We keep destroying the world around us and we refuse to take responsibility, but if we don’t it’s going to come back to bite us.
Agree or disagree with the message, no one can deny that a violent cartoon music video about revenge is top notch.
